Comparing Energy Sector Consulting Firms: What to Look For
Understanding the Role of Energy Sector Consulting Firms
In today's rapidly evolving energy landscape, consulting firms play a critical role in helping companies navigate challenges and seize opportunities. Whether it's transitioning to renewable energy sources, optimizing operational efficiency, or complying with stringent regulations, these firms offer invaluable expertise. But with so many options available, how do you choose the right one?

Key Factors to Consider
When comparing energy sector consulting firms, several factors warrant careful consideration. First and foremost, assess the firm's experience and expertise in your specific area of interest. A firm with a proven track record in renewable energy might be the best choice for a company looking to reduce its carbon footprint.
Next, examine the firm's reputation and credibility. Look for companies that have demonstrated success through client testimonials, case studies, and industry recognition. A reputable firm will have no shortage of satisfied clients willing to share their positive experiences.
Comprehensive Service Offerings
Another crucial aspect is the range of services provided. Ideally, the consulting firm should offer a comprehensive suite of services that align with your needs. These might include:
- Strategic Planning
- Regulatory Compliance
- Risk Management
- Technology Implementation

Cost vs. Value
While cost is always a consideration, it shouldn't be the sole determining factor. Instead, focus on the value for money that a firm provides. A slightly higher fee might be justified if it results in substantial improvements in efficiency or compliance outcomes.
To determine value, consider the firm's ability to deliver measurable results and their approach to problem-solving. A firm that emphasizes collaboration and innovation can often provide solutions that are not only effective but also sustainable in the long term.
Cultural Fit and Communication
The importance of cultural fit cannot be overstated. The consulting firm's values and working style should complement your company's culture. This alignment fosters better communication and more effective collaboration.

Effective communication is another critical factor. The firm should be transparent about its processes and maintain open lines of communication throughout the engagement. Regular updates and clear reporting can make a significant difference in the project's success.
Evaluating Firm Credentials
Finally, take time to evaluate the credentials of the consulting firm. Certifications, industry affiliations, and awards can provide insight into their level of expertise and commitment to excellence. Additionally, consider their global reach if your operations extend beyond local markets.
By considering these factors, you can make an informed decision when selecting an energy sector consulting firm that aligns with your business goals and objectives.
